Gortalassa Fort
There is a fort in the townland of Gortalassa, Firies. It is in Jerry Kerrsk's land. There is a fence of earth around it. In the centre of this fort there is an entrance-hole. Over this entrance there is a big stone. The weight of the stone is about twenty tons. There is another fort about a half a mile from it. They are in the same townland. The two forts are connected by an under-ground tunnel. It is built of flags. A person could travel from one fort to the other. There is supposed to be a large crock of gold hidden in some one of those forts by the Danes retreating from Dromore fort.
